Output 656431dccf29d5d68e03c01a539f2d97fe6bb58da8cd942df6a45ac5be4e595a:0

value
146331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2e8823ad945f6f4d9b37f879163e520326d93c OP_EQUALVERIFY OP_CHECKSIG
address
18Dg8EwZkmUxBMQi791iELaBbK8pwShgfp
transaction
656431dccf29d5d68e03c01a539f2d97fe6bb58da8cd942df6a45ac5be4e595a
spent
true